| Re: Unlocking T-Mobile Blackberry Pearl 8100
dacket - have you signed up for the data plan with cingy/att yet? if so, then you should create your BIS account here: http://bis.na.blackberry.com/html?brand=mycingular once you create this, you can resend service books or, if you have an icon titled "setup personal email" you can do it that way too ![]() also try to register the handheld and see if that brings the browser back options/advanced options/host routing table click menu and choose register now |
